Understanding Short Term Drug Rehab in North Pole, Alaska

Short term drug and alcohol rehab is among the effective types of addiction rehabilitation. That is, it might be helpful for clients in North Pole who are unable to go to a long-term rehab program.

Yet, there are numerous factors you need to look into when choosing the rehab facility you are thinking about attending. The three major concerns encompass cost, success rates/effectiveness, and program duration.

Considering that no universal recovery plan will work for all addicts, you will have a few options to decide on subject to your particular needs and desires. One of these options is short term drug rehabilitation.

In many instances, short term rehabilitation will require that you live within the treatment program for a couple of weeks or so. These programs are similar to long-term rehab programs except they last quite a bit shorter yet at the same time making sure that you obtain the support, attention, and supervision to ensure you do not relapse.

Specifically, short term treatment will range in duration from 14 days to about 6 weeks. During this time, you may receive individual and group counseling and therapy even as you start learning effective life skills that will empower you to deal with any problematic situation you encounter rather than resorting to substance abuse.

In most cases, short term rehab in North Pole, AK. will start with medically managed detox. The length of this program will primarily depend on the dose and frequency of your addiction as well as for how long you have been using.

After you complete detoxification, the short term rehab facility will use other methods of treatment tailored to your individual needs. For example, the program may use 12-step meetings and group counseling to allow you to take advantage of peer support. These treatments will hold you accountable as you try to overcome your recovery.

Other forms of treatment that might be offered in short term rehabilitation include:

  • Acupuncture
  • Art therapy
  • Cognitive behavioral therapy
  • Group counseling
  • Individual counseling
  • Medication
  • Nature therapy
  • Treatment for co-occurring mental health conditions like anxiety and depression
  • Yoga

These treatment methods can be used in short term drug rehab to help modify your behavior, discourage you from continued drug use, and show you how to make positive choices so that you do not fall back into substance abuse. You may also discover new coping skills and help you to reduce anxiety, so you don't feel you need to abuse drugs or alcohol.

Volunteers of America is a nonprofit human service organization dedicated to the relief of human suffering and the advancement of social justice. It was founded in 1896 by Christian social reformers Ballington and Maud Booth in New York City. Today Volunteers of America is active in more than 220 communities throughout the United States, helping over one million people every year. Charity Navigator, the nation largest evaluator of charities, has awarded its top rating, 4 stars, to Volunteers of America for successfully managing the finances of the organization in an efficient and effective manner.
